About 1199 Old Lathemtown Rd

Sellers will contribute towards painting the exterior and kitchen of the home. Nestled on 1.78 secluded wooded acres, this expansive 8-bedroom, 6-bathroom farmhouse is situated among neighboring estate homes and picturesque horse farms. Accompanied by a stunning saltwater pool and a versatile sports court, this property promises both entertainment and relaxation. Inside, a gourmet chef's kitchen, equipped with top-of-the-line SS appliances, seamlessly flows into a cozy family room, all accentuated by rich hardwood flooring. An expansive butler's pantry conveniently connects the dining area, optimizing space and function. The elegant main-level primary suite features two custom-designed closets, a luxurious tiled rain shower, and dual vanities in the bathroom. Additionally, a fully equipped apartment suite is perfect for multi-generational living with a kitchen, living area, full main-level bedroom, and an additional loft bedroom. The expansive screened porch overlooks the spacious fenced backyard and outdoor entertainment space. Perfect for large get-togethers. Venture upstairs to find oversized secondary bedrooms, each thoughtfully designed with ample storage. Dive deeper into the home, and you'll find a fully finished terrace level complete with a kitchenette, bedroom, bathroom, gym, and a sizable family/game room. The backyard is an entertainer's dream with a tucked-away "man cave" complete with a full bar and lounge. Dive into the deep saltwater pool, engage in a game on the basketball court, or gather around the expansive firepit area with integrated swing seating. Additionally, there's a storage shed with a fenced paddock. This home is in the coveted Creekview High School district of Cherokee County. It is conveniently located just 5 minutes from 7 Acre Barngrill and Milton Publix, 15 minutes from Milton's Downtown Crabapple District, and 20 minutes from Downtown Alpharetta and Avalon.

Living in Canton, GA

Transportation in Canton includes a network of major roads and highways that facilitate travel and commuting to nearby cities and attractions. Public transit options are available, providing residents with alternatives to private vehicle use. The area's walkability varies, with certain neighborhoods offering more pedestrian-friendly environments than others. Bike paths and lanes are also present in some parts of the city, encouraging a healthy and eco-friendly mode of transportation. Ride-sharing services are operational in the area, complementing the existing transport infrastructure.

The community is served by a comprehensive educational system, including a number of public and private schools that cater to a range of educational needs. Canton is home to several healthcare facilities offering a spectrum of medical services, from primary care to specialized treatments. The public library system supports lifelong learning with a variety of programs and resources. Retail and dining options reflect the local culture, with an array of shops and restaurants that range from familiar chains to unique local establishments.

Canton prides itself on a warm community spirit and a rich historical heritage that is celebrated through various local events and festivals throughout the year. The city's character is defined by its blend of small-town charm and growing suburban amenities, offering residents a peaceful yet vibrant lifestyle. The community is known for its well-maintained parks and recreational areas that provide a scenic backdrop for family activities and outdoor enthusiasts.

Canton, Cherokee, Georgia, offers a diverse housing market with a blend of residential options to suit various preferences. The housing landscape features a selection of single-family homes, which are the most prevalent, complemented by a mix of apartments and townhouses. Architectural styles in the area range from traditional Southern charm to contemporary designs, with a noticeable number of properties reflecting the craftsman style. The majority of homes were constructed during a development boom in the late 20th century, with many neighborhoods established in the 1990s.
